For example, Sweden locals believe conversation is meant for exchanging meaningful information. Casual chatting is seen as pointless, and many Swedes will go out of their way to avoid it by not making eye contact. Swedes also value privacy and are not likely to divulge personal information with strangers. Small talk questions might seem innocent to bring up with people of different cultures, but that’s not always the case.
